Voice messages (network service)
The voice mailbox is a network service and you may need to subscribe to it. For more information and for the 
voice mailbox number, contact your service provider.
Select 
Menu
 > 
Messages
 > 
Voice messages
. To call your voice mailbox, select 
Listen to voice messages
. To 
enter, search for, or edit your voice mailbox number, select 
Voice mailbox number
If supported by the network, the indicator 
 will show new voice messages. Select 
Listen
 to call your voice 
mailbox number.
Tip: Pressing and holding 1 calls your voice mailbox if you have the number set.

Service commands
Select 
Menu
 > 
Messages
 > 
Service commands
. Enter and send service requests (also known as USSD 
commands), such as activation commands for network services, to your service provider.
Delete all messages from a folder
To delete all messages from a folder, select 
Menu
 > 
Messages
 > 
Delete messages
. Select the folder from which 
you want to delete the messages, and select 
OK
 to confirm the query.
If the folder contains unread messages, the phone will ask whether you want to delete them also.
